Demographics Quick Facts

  • The population density in River Sioux is 84% higher than Iowa
  • The median age in River Sioux is 19% lower than Iowa
  • In River Sioux 100.00% of the population is White
  • In River Sioux 0.00% of the population is Black
  • In River Sioux 0.00% of the population is Asian
